AI complier Renesas is developing is the software which can generate high-performance executable code for Renesas’s R-Car device from pre-trained deep neural network.


Background

Performing CNN inference in real time is very challenging work because embedded hardware faces severe restrictions in the hardware resources of computation and power consumption. In order to performing CNN inference effectively on R-Car V series device, Renesas designed the heterogeneous architecture, which is divided into a programmable processor (CPU) and the accelerators dedicated for computing each layer of the network.


As for AI complier, the common software architecture contains two parts: the compiler “Front end” and the complier “Back end” as shown in the figure. Deep neural networks are translated into multi-level IRs in AI compiler. The complier front end is responsible for hardware-independent transformations (graph IR) and graph optimizations while the complier back end is responsible for hardware-specific optimizations, code generation.


Renesas is mainly developing the hardware-dependent optimization algorithm, by making maximum use of the heterogeneous architecture of R-Car V series. 


Deep neural network is one of the technology field which has been extensively studied in recent years and continues to evolve. Renesas will provide the advanced AI tool to assist the development of autonomous driving technology.
